On 17/10/07 16:58, "Kieran Mansley" <kmansley@xxxxxxxxxxxxxx> wrote:

> The second ioremap calls get_vm_area() and happens to be given a region
> of virtual memory that at least partly overlaps the area that was used
> for the first one.  As the area was freed by the iounmap() in the middle
> this seems sensible, but then when it comes to get the PTE for the
> virtual addresses in the second map, it finds there are entries left
> over from the first one.

Well, that's bogus. iounmap() should zap all PTEs via remove_vm_area(). If
it's not doing so then we have a bug.
